How Does Satellite Radio Work

Satellite radio is a digital broadcast sent through a communications satellite to a receiver in your home or car. You will be able to receive the signal for a satellite radio anywhere where there is line of sight between your receiver and the satellite, given that there are no major obstacles such as tunnels or buildings. A subscriber of this service will be able to access satellite radio channels at any location.

Introduction to Satellite Digital Audio Radio service(SDARS)

Satellite Digital Audio Radio Service (SDARS) is a Satellite based Radio Broadcast service. It commercially started in the earliest in this century. In an SDARS system digitally encoded audio material is broadcast to Earth-based receivers, which could reproduce the signal that are transmitted. Since the satellite-based digital broadcast is employed compact-disc quality audio is available in a large region (vast enough to a continent) compared to conventional Radio Audio Broadcast.
